The Yogi Adityanath-led Uttar Pradesh government has reserved 5% of its Group C posts for ex-servicemen of the armed forces
 

Bengaluru: The Yogi Adityanath-led Uttar Pradesh government has reserved 5% of its Group C posts for ex-servicemen of the armed forces. These ex-servicemen should be original residents of Uttar Pradesh. 

In this regard, the UP cabinet made an amendment to the Uttar Pradesh Public Service (Reservation for Physically Handicapped, Dependents of Freedom Fighters and Ex-Servicemen) Act, 1993. 

A UP government official said, “With this decision, the morale of former officers and employees of the Indian Army will be increased and their family will get effective support.” 

The government of Uttar Pradesh also increased the financial support provided to the family of martyred serviceperson of the armed forces. It has been increased to Rs. 50 lakh from the earlier Rs. 25 lakh. 

A popular website reported that the government announced that the state had made arrangements for the employment of dependents of the martyred soldiers. The dependents of the soldiers who were martyred after 01 April 2017 will get jobs in the government departments.
